However, I'm wondering about how a programmer would try to "future-proof" his CS knowledge. Is it more important to learn the math, algorithms, and logic instead of focusing primarily on languages?
What are the trends you guys see in computer science right now? What knowledge will still be valuable in the future, 30-50 years from now?